What is the Maximum Size of a tree that can be Moved?
The size of a tree that can be moved depends on a variety of factors, including the type of tree and its root system and the equipment being employed. The majority of trees have the diameter of a trunk that is 24 inches or less and the height of up to 30 feet are able to be moved easily. However, trees that are bigger than that can be transported, but they require the use of specialized equipment and experienced arborists.
Factors that Impact The Movement of Trees
There are several factors that come into play when moving trees. These include the following: Types of Tree: Some tree species are more challenging to move than others, because they have bigger root systems or are more fragile. Root System The dimension and complexness of the root system trees can significantly impact the ease of moving it. Trees with large root systems might require trimming before they can be moved. Equipment: The kind and dimension of the equipment used to move a tree can dramatically affect the speed of the job. Larger trees might require cranes or specialized equipment for tree removal. Distance: The distance that the tree needs to be moved can also affect the difficulty of the job.

Can all trees be removed?
Some trees are not able to be moved successfully. Trees that are extremely old, damaged or have extensive root systems might not be suitable for moving.
What is the price of moving a tree?
The cost of moving a tree may vary widely based on its size, distance it needs to be moved, and the difficulty of the job. In general, the cost of moving a tree may be anywhere from a few hundred to several thousand dollars.
What is the time it takes to remove the tree?
The length of duration required to move a tree differ greatly based on its size as well as the complexity of the task. It can take anywhere from several hours to a full day to move a tree.
